The easiest thing to knit for a baby is a baby blanket or baby booties. These projects typically involve straightforward patterns, making them ideal for beginners. A baby blanket allows you to practice basic stitches, while booties are small and quick to complete, providing immediate gratification.

- What is the easiest knitting project for a baby? The easiest knitting projects for a baby are baby blankets and baby booties, as they involve simple stitches and patterns suitable for beginners.
- Can beginners knit baby booties quickly? Yes, baby booties are small projects that can be completed quickly, making them ideal for beginners looking for immediate results.
- What basic stitches are used in knitting a baby blanket? Basic stitches such as knit and purl are commonly used in knitting baby blankets, allowing beginners to practice and improve their skills.
